Your local lumber-yard probably only sell plywood in 8 ft by 4 ft sheets, this is the size most frequently required by the average Do It Yourselfer, or carpenter.

To get custom sized sheets, you will probably need to contact a manufacturer directly. You could ask the manager/owner of you local lumber-yard, who manufactures their plywood, or if they can get you what you need on special order.
